Use the Participant Timeline
TrialPath
In a participant record, the Timeline shows information about the participant’s status, consents, eligibility, and enrollment, arranged by dates. This makes it easy to view and edit participant progress throughout the study.
As the participant progresses through the study, the markers on the timeline change from gray to green with a white checkmark to show the participant’s current place in the study. To enter or edit information on the timeline, click the pencil icon.

Prescreening: View and update the Date Entered Prescreening and Prescreening ID, if applicable.
In Screening: View and update the Date Entered Screening and Screening ID.
Consent: Shows whether the participant consented (
) refused (
) or waived (
) the consent. Click the pencil icon to view and update consent information including Consent version, Consented/Refused/Waived, Consent Date, and Notes. To select and upload a consent document, at the right of the consent name, click Upload Consent Document. To view or download the consent document, click Consent Documents. To add a new consent to the timeline, at the top right, click Add Consent.
Eligible: View and update the eligibility information including Eligible/Ineligible, Eligibility Date, and Notes. To view inclusion and exclusion criteria for the study, click View Eligibility Criteria.
Enrolled: View and update the enrollment information including Enrolled/Declined, Enrollment Date, Subject ID, Enrolling Research Coordinator, Enrolling Investigator, and Notes.
